OLEXP: Error Message: The Message Cannot Be Sent...

SYMPTOMS
When you attempt to send an e-mail message in Outlook Express, you may receive the following error message:
The message cannot be sent. An error has occurred.
When you attempt to save or close the e-mail message, you may receive the following error message:
Cannot save this message.
CAUSE
These error messages can occur if your e-mail address is missing from the E-Mail Address box in the properties of the account you are using to send the e-mail message.
RESOLUTION
To resolve this issue, follow these steps in Outlook Express:

1. On the Tools menu, click Accounts.
2. Click the Mail tab, click the account you want to use to send the e-mail message, and then click Properties.
3. On the General tab, type your e-mail address in the E-Mail Address box.
4. Click OK, and then click Close.
